#d4a5c0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d4a5c0 is composed of 83.1% red, 64.7%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.2% magenta, 9.4%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 325.5 degrees, a saturation of 35.3% and a lightness of 73.9%. #d4a5c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a94b81.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#d4a5c0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d4a5c0 has RGB values of R:212, G:165, B:192 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.22, Y:0.09,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13936064.
